WebThe shortest common superstring problem (SCS) has been widely studied for its applications in string compression and DNA sequence assembly. Although it is known to be Max-SNP hard, the simple greedy algorithm works extremely well in practice. Application of a greedy heuristic to the shortest common superstring problem (SCS): Given a set of strings, find the shortest string such that every input string is a substring of the generated string. This problem has applications in data compression and in DNA sequencing. Since SCS is NP-hard, fast heuristics are important. Requirements: 1.
